Introduction

Qwen-Drive-1.0 retains the architecture of the pretrained Qwen3.5 vision-language model and integrates 3D perception, visual question answering, and motion planning within a unified framework. The natively multimodal Qwen3.5-4B serves as the shared VLM, with two external modules attached:

  • A BEV Perception Head jointly performs 3D object detection, semantic occupancy

prediction, and BEV map segmentation. It serves as a probe of the 3D information accessible from the shared representations and provides an explicit, inspectable interface to 3D scene structure.

  • A Planning Expert conditions on shared VLM representations to generate future ego

trajectories.

  • The original VLM's LLM Decoder remains unchanged, and can handle both General VQA and Driving VQA tasks.

We propose a staged training strategy that integrates perception, language, and planning objectives. By combining driving-specific supervision with general-purpose vision-language data, the model achieves specialized driving competence while retaining broad visual understanding and instruction-following capabilities. This approach is supported by a unified data pipeline that: (1) maps heterogeneous perception annotations into a shared label space; (2) re-annotates driving VQA responses to ensure format and factual consistency; and (3) standardizes trajectories from multiple public driving datasets into a unified waypoint representation.

Performance

Planning

| | SFT | RL | | --- | --- | --- | | NAVSIM v1.1 navtest, PDMS | 88.2 (89.3 best-of-6) | 90.7 (91.4 best-of-6) | | Waymo Open Dataset E2E test, RFS | 7.78 | 7.91 | | NVIDIA PhysicalAI open-loop, minADE 3 s | 0.34 m | 0.38 m |

SFT is the imitation-trained Planning Expert. RL is the same expert after reward optimization on the benchmark objectives. Both share one VLM. 3D detection, occupancy and map segmentation results are in [the technical report](#citation), full planning tables in [docs/evaluation.md](docs/evaluation.md).

Models

The model can be downloaded from Hugging Face or ModelScope. Everything ships in one directory. The VLM sits at its root, shared by every task, and each task head in a subfolder beside it.

Qwen-Drive-1.0-4B/ 9.1 GB the VLM, which on its own serves the VQA mode
├── planner-sft/ 2.1 GB Planning Expert, imitation-trained
├── planner-rl/ 2.1 GB Planning Expert after reward optimization
└── perception/ 0.5 GB BEV perception head
